The retry path in Paylark's checkout worker now derives idempotency keys from the order hash plus attempt epoch, not the raw timestamp. This closes the replay window we discussed: a duplicate POST within the dedupe horizon returns the cached authorization instead of re-charging. Keys are stored in the ledger cache with a TTL longer than the gateway's settlement delay. Please verify the key derivation can't collide across tenants. The relevant tuning constants are below.

tuning table, yajog-yahof:
BUDGETS = {
    "lamvan": 303,
    "wenox": 460,
    "fenvan": 525,
}

Subject: Ownership change — ChipGate reader firmware

Hi all,

Effective next sprint, responsibility for the ChipGate marathon timing-chip reader moves from the Trackside team to the Devices group at Hollowbrook Sports Systems. Release candidates still follow the standard two-stage rollout, but firmware sign-off now routes through Devices. Please update the release checklist accordingly. Going forward, all reader-related release approvals should be directed to:

account owner for bawip-tahag: Raleth Quenok

RateLens polls partner hotel feeds on a rolling schedule, so throughput is bounded by the crawl concurrency and per-domain politeness delay rather than CPU. During the Averford pilot we saw queue depth spike whenever more than three regional feeds refreshed simultaneously; the worker pool absorbs this as long as the drain rate stays above incoming comparisons. Memory is dominated by the in-flight comparison cache, which we cap explicitly. Please review the following values against the pilot load numbers before approving.

constants for hahaf-fawif:
RATE_LIMITS = {
    "holir": 5,
    "ruswyn": 499,
    "istion": 753,
}

## Deep-Link Routing Escalation

Symptom: Fernpath app opens to home screen instead of target view. Check the Routemap config version first — a stale push is the usual cause. Roll back via the Beaconet console; propagation takes ~5 min. If links still misroute, pull a trace from the Linkprobe tool and confirm the universal-link manifest matches the deployed build. Do not hotfix routing rules in prod. If rollback fails or the manifest is corrupted, escalate immediately to the mobile platform rotation.

escalation mailbox, bafog-fafog: ulador@paliqlabs.internal